Viber Enhances Group Chats with New AI Summarization Tool

In a digital age where our conversations often span hundreds of messages, Viber has introduced an ingenious solution to keep users from being overwhelmed: an AI chat summarizer. This new feature taps into the power of OpenAI to offer group chat participants a digestible overview of discussions they’ve missed. Imagine skimming through a neat list of bullet points that captures the heart of a discussion, rather than scrolling endlessly through a sea of messages.

The summarizer is designed to distill action points and major threads from up to a hundred messages, presenting them in clear, concise points. This could be revolutionary for busy parents managing their children’s schedules, friends arranging get-togethers, or travel groups sorting out plans. The convenience of having the gist of a lengthy conversation handed to you cannot be overstated.

Using this feature is a breeze—upon entering a group chat with a stack of unread messages, users will get a prompt to generate an AI-crafted summary. Viber pledges a commitment to privacy, ensuring these summaries are only visible to the user who requested them and they do not contain sensitive personal information.

Initially available to users in select countries including the US, Japan, and Ukraine, the feature supports over 50 languages, aiming to reach a broad audience.
